The 2004 historical epic remains one of Hollywood's most ambitious adaptations of ancient Greek mythology. Directed by Wolfgang Petersen, the film brought Homer’s Iliad to life with a star-studded cast and massive-scale production. While historians often point out the film's deviations from Greek mythology (such as the deaths of certain characters who survive in the myths), Troy succeeds as a "humanized" epic. By removing the literal presence of the Greek Gods—who are central in the Iliad —the movie places the weight of destiny entirely on human shoulders. Conclusion
